The Brightkelp public API is dropping offset pagination in v4. Replace every `?page=` parameter with the opaque `cursor` token returned in each response envelope, and honor the `next_cursor` field rather than computing offsets client-side. Note that cursors expire after 15 minutes, so long-running exports must checkpoint. Before deploying, backfill the cursor index table — the migration script expects the sequence column to exist. Run the backfill against the staging database using the connection string below.

warehouse DSN: mssql://rusdor_svc:0FSWCn9@db-951a.paliqforge.local:5432/ulawyn

/*
 * Retry ceiling for the Stockmere inventory reconciliation job.
 * Exceeding three retries risks double-counting transfers that
 * were mid-flight when the first attempt failed, so do not raise
 * this during an incident without first draining the transfer
 * queue. Each reconciliation run stamps its output with the
 * trace value shown on the next line.
 */

session token of yahof-bajeg = htk9_0d43d44ed

## Deploying the Gatewick Proctor Queue

Deploys are pretty painless: push to main, wait for the pipeline, then watch the queue drain dashboard for five minutes. If candidates pile up mid-exam, roll back first and ask questions later — the queue replays safely. Everything the workers care about lives in one config block, shown here for reference.

settings of bafof-yagef:
JOROX_PIN=8740
JOROX_TENANT=pelox
JOROX_METRICS_HOST=metrics.jorox.qorvelworks.internal
JOROX_SEAL=seal_c78f63c1
JOROX_STANDBY_TEAM=norax

Quick note before the sync: the Harborline garage occupancy feed is polling way too aggressively when a level flips to full, and we're hammering the Pinedale gateway for no reason. I'd rather we tune the backoff than add another cache layer. Take a look at the poll intervals I'm proposing in these constants.

tuning constants:
BUDGETS = {
    "druath": 240,
    "lamwyn": 180,
    "silael": 275,
}